Hedychium flavescens

Description

Hedychium flavescens is a beautiful variety sometimes known as ‘The yellow Ginger’ with stunning large leaves, much like banana plants.  During mid to late summer, fragrant creamy-yellow exotic flowers appear.  Plant in free draining fertile soil in a sunny to semi shaded position.  Apply a layer of bark mulch during winter once stems have died back, or lift the rhizomes and store in a container in compost.
